Responsibilities and Duties:
  • Conducts regular inspections of the Early Childhood, Lower School, and Upper School buildings to identify and address maintenance needs promptly.
  • Responds to facility work orders originating from building users, using established processes, and develops new processes as appropriate
  • Works with the Head of Facilities to schedule and perform regular preventive maintenance on all building systems, including MEP, roofs, finishes, and other equipment.
  • Assists in overseeing contracted cleaning services with the assistance of the Head of Facilities.
  • Assists the Head of Facilities with organizing, scheduling, and supervising all repairs and construction projects, with sensitivity to TPCS seasonality and operational needs.
  • Collaborates with program and staff leadership to understand special needs and maintain quality of support to the mission (e.g., academic leaders, food services, athletics, transportation, and security).
  • Completes set-up and tear-down for the Early Childhood on Thursdays, Fridays, and Sundays.
  • Collaborates with colleagues
  • Provides facility support to campus events (e.g., setups and teardowns).
  • Assists with student transportation (drop-off starts at 7:40 am, driving the bus for dismissal, etc.).
  • Responds quickly to emergency situations (kid sickness, snow removal, meeting with vendors, etc.) in a timely manner.
  • Ensures the facilities are clean throughout the school day.
  • Maintains inventory of tools and supplies for custodial, maintenance, and emergency preparedness.
  • Performs a wide variety of skilled maintenance duties related to the schools.
  • Creates and updates standard operating procedures.
  • Other duties as assigned.
Physical Requirements:
  • Frequently lift equipment and materials weighing 50 pounds or more.
  • Crawl, climb ladders, twist, turn, and reach in completing a variety of job duties.
  • Work outside in hot or cold conditions for extended periods of time.
  • Work in a wide variety of environments as found in all areas of the TPCS.
Exempt Status: Exempt, salariedWork Schedule: 12 months, Monday - Friday 7:30 am - 4:00 pm (with occasional weekends or nights depending on the event).
